Francesca Celletti is a prominent medical professional and one of the leading doctors at the World Health Organization (WHO), where she focuses on health promotion and disease prevention. Her expertise includes the management of chronic diseases, particularly obesity, and she has played a significant role in shaping global health policies regarding new treatment modalities, such as GLP-1 therapies. Recently, she contributed to a WHO statement that emphasizes the importance of weight loss drugs in combating the global obesity epidemic.
